Well guys I know I don't post very much but I lurk all the time. I was planning on starting to look for a G in July but wanted to wait until October for incentives/rebates on 08's. Long story short my 01 Passat is a piece and I sink $1500 plus a year on it just to keep it running. Guess what happned last week, yup died again. After sinking $1300 into it just to get it running and all of the engine codes cleared up I decided to trade it in before the turbo blew or the timing belt went.

The new ride is a G35x w/ prem and nav in platnum. I went in to the delearship planning on buying a G35x w/ prem and sport in slate blue. The delearship would not take anything lower then $900 over invoice for the sport and said they would sell any non sport model for invoice. I kinda thought it was a bluff so I said ok I'll take one w/ prem and nav since I did not want the Tech package. My color choices were black, red or silver. Black (IMO) looks the best but way to hard to keep up w/ a 3 and 5 year old with bikes and scooters around all the time. I don't like red much on cars so silver it was. Ended up getting it for $18 over invoice. For the price difference I think Nav is worth more then the sport package. And with the 2.9% financing I don't think I could have done much better. Still kinda wish I would have got the Slate Blue but the only way to get it without paying over invoice would have to just get the premium package and I didn't just because I think you get so much with the navigation package.
